楼主: 6513
13340 1

[数据管理求助] stata 将字符型数据转换成数值型数据 [推广有奖]

  • 2关注
  • 13粉丝

已卖:4069份资源

博士生

82%

还不是VIP/贵宾

-

TA的文库  其他...

读一本好书

威望
0
论坛币
17424 个
通用积分
600.6155
学术水平
22 点
热心指数
18 点
信用等级
16 点
经验
29645 点
帖子
277
精华
0
在线时间
326 小时
注册时间
2013-1-20
最后登录
2025-12-14

楼主
6513 在职认证  发表于 2017-10-8 21:00:08 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
在处理charls数据时,要进行区域划分,找到了各个省的变量,但是却没办法转换。

看了论坛的帖子,试了encode  和destring 命令,都无济于事,不明白到底怎么了。

求坛友帮我看看

我的目标:  将province 重新赋值,分成东部、中部、西部三个区域



----------------------- copy starting from the next line -----------------------
  1. * Example generated by -dataex-. To install: ssc install dataex
  2. clear
  3. input str7 communityID str16 province str20 city byte urban_nbs str3 areatype float nprovince
  4. "0940041" "北京"         "北京"       1 "111" 0
  5. "0940042" "北京"         "北京"       1 "111" 0
  6. "0940043" "北京"         "北京"       1 "111" 0
  7. "1940373" "天津"         "天津"       1 "112" 0
  8. "1940371" "天津"         "天津"       1 "112" 0
  9. "1940372" "天津"         "天津"       1 "111" 0
  10. "0640283" "河北省"       "石家庄市"   1 "111" 0
  11. "0640282" "河北省"       "石家庄市"   1 "111" 0
  12. "0640281" "河北省"       "石家庄市"   1 "111" 0
  13. "0640332" "河北省"       "石家庄市"   0 "220" 0
  14. "0640331" "河北省"       "石家庄市"   0 "220" 0
  15. "0640333" "河北省"       "石家庄市"   0 "220" 0
  16. "0604813" "河北省"       "保定市"     0 "220" 0
  17. "0604811" "河北省"       "保定市"     0 "220" 0
  18. "0604812" "河北省"       "保定市"     0 "220" 0
  19. "0604401" "河北省"       "保定市"     0 "220" 0
  20. "0604403" "河北省"       "保定市"     0 "220" 0
  21. "0604402" "河北省"       "保定市"     0 "220" 0
  22. "0655463" "河北省"       "承德市"     0 "220" 0
  23. "0655461" "河北省"       "承德市"     0 "220" 0
  24. "0655462" "河北省"       "承德市"     0 "220" 0
  25. "0646043" "河北省"       "沧州市"     1 "111" 0
  26. "0646041" "河北省"       "沧州市"     1 "111" 0
  27. "0646042" "河北省"       "沧州市"     1 "111" 0
  28. "1711591" "山西省"       "阳泉市"     0 "220" 0
  29. "1711593" "山西省"       "阳泉市"     0 "220" 0
  30. "1711592" "山西省"       "阳泉市"     0 "220" 0
  31. "1755311" "山西省"       "运城市"     1 "111" 0
  32. "1755312" "山西省"       "运城市"     0 "220" 0
  33. "1755313" "山西省"       "运城市"     0 "220" 0
  34. "1746433" "山西省"       "忻州市"     1 "121" 0
  35. "1746432" "山西省"       "忻州市"     0 "220" 0
  36. "1746431" "山西省"       "忻州市"     0 "220" 0
  37. "1774022" "山西省"       "临汾市"     1 "122" 0
  38. "1774023" "山西省"       "临汾市"     0 "210" 0
  39. "1774021" "山西省"       "临汾市"     0 "210" 0
  40. "1040041" "内蒙古自治区" "呼和浩特市" 1 "111" 0
  41. "1040043" "内蒙古自治区" "呼和浩特市" 1 "111" 0
  42. "1040042" "内蒙古自治区" "呼和浩特市" 1 "111" 0
  43. "1053811" "内蒙古自治区" "赤峰市"     1 "121" 0
  44. "1053813" "内蒙古自治区" "赤峰市"     1 "121" 0
  45. "1053812" "内蒙古自治区" "赤峰市"     0 "220" 0
  46. "1082593" "内蒙古自治区" "呼伦贝尔市" 1 "121" 0
  47. "1082592" "内蒙古自治区" "呼伦贝尔市" 1 "121" 0
  48. "1082591" "内蒙古自治区" "呼伦贝尔市" 0 "220" 0
  49. "1082061" "内蒙古自治区" "呼伦贝尔市" 0 "220" 0
  50. "1082063" "内蒙古自治区" "呼伦贝尔市" 0 "220" 0
  51. "1082062" "内蒙古自治区" "呼伦贝尔市" 0 "220" 0
  52. "1051022" "内蒙古自治区" "兴安盟"     1 "121" 0
  53. "1051023" "内蒙古自治区" "兴安盟"     1 "121" 0
  54. "1051021" "内蒙古自治区" "兴安盟"     1 "121" 0
  55. "1017912" "内蒙古自治区" "锡林郭勒盟" 1 "121" 0
  56. "1017911" "内蒙古自治区" "锡林郭勒盟" 0 "220" 0
  57. "1017913" "内蒙古自治区" "锡林郭勒盟" 0 "220" 0
  58. "1624313" "辽宁省"       "大连市"     1 "111" 0
  59. "1624311" "辽宁省"       "大连市"     1 "111" 0
  60. "1624312" "辽宁省"       "大连市"     0 "220" 0
  61. "1611593" "辽宁省"       "鞍山市"     1 "121" 0
  62. "1611592" "辽宁省"       "鞍山市"     0 "220" 0
  63. "1611591" "辽宁省"       "鞍山市"     0 "220" 0
  64. "1601041" "辽宁省"       "本溪市"     1 "111" 0
  65. "1601042" "辽宁省"       "本溪市"     1 "111" 0
  66. "1601043" "辽宁省"       "本溪市"     1 "111" 0
  67. "1682313" "辽宁省"       "锦州市"     1 "111" 0
  68. "1682311" "辽宁省"       "锦州市"     0 "220" 0
  69. "1682312" "辽宁省"       "锦州市"     0 "220" 0
  70. "1660063" "辽宁省"       "朝阳市"     0 "220" 0
  71. "1660062" "辽宁省"       "朝阳市"     0 "220" 0
  72. "1660061" "辽宁省"       "朝阳市"     0 "220" 0
  73. "2124281" "吉林省"       "吉林市"     1 "111" 0
  74. "2124282" "吉林省"       "吉林市"     1 "111" 0
  75. "2124283" "吉林省"       "吉林市"     1 "121" 0
  76. "2111763" "吉林省"       "四平市"     1 "121" 0
  77. "2111761" "吉林省"       "四平市"     0 "220" 0
  78. "2111762" "吉林省"       "四平市"     0 "220" 0
  79. "2111542" "吉林省"       "四平市"     1 "111" 0
  80. "2111541" "吉林省"       "四平市"     1 "111" 0
  81. "2111543" "吉林省"       "四平市"     0 "220" 0
  82. "1440163" "黑龙江省"     "哈尔滨市"   1 "111" 0
  83. "1440161" "黑龙江省"     "哈尔滨市"   1 "111" 0
  84. "1440162" "黑龙江省"     "哈尔滨"     1 "111" 0
  85. "1424032" "黑龙江省"     "齐齐哈尔市" 1 "121" 0
  86. "1424033" "黑龙江省"     "齐齐哈尔市" 1 "121" 0
  87. "1424031" "黑龙江省"     "齐齐哈尔市" 1 "121" 0
  88. "1411542" "黑龙江省"     "鸡西市"     1 "111" 0
  89. "1411543" "黑龙江省"     "鸡西市"     0 "220" 0
  90. "1411541" "黑龙江省"     "鸡西市"     0 "220" 0
  91. "1455283" "黑龙江省"     "佳木斯市"   1 "111" 0
  92. "1455281" "黑龙江省"     "佳木斯市"   1 "111" 0
  93. "1455282" "黑龙江省"     "佳木斯市"   1 "111" 0
  94. "1840373" "上海市"       "上海市"     1 "111" 0
  95. "1840371" "上海市"       "上海市"     1 "111" 0
  96. "1840372" "上海市"       "上海市"     1 "111" 0
  97. "1111541" "江苏省"       "徐州市"     1 "111" 0
  98. "1111543" "江苏省"       "徐州市"     1 "111" 0
  99. "1111542" "江苏省"       "徐州市"     1 "122" 0
  100. "1101311" "江苏省"       "苏州市"     0 "220" 0
  101. "1101312" "江苏省"       "苏州市"     1 "121" 0
  102. "1101313" "江苏省"       "苏州市"     0 "220" 0
  103. "1182763" "江苏省"       "连云港市"   0 "220" 0
  104. end
  105. label values urban_nbs ur
  106. label def ur 0 "Rural", modify
  107. label def ur 1 "Urban", modify
复制代码
------------------ copy up to and including the previous line ------------------

二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:字符型变量;数值型变量;

沙发
6513 在职认证  发表于 2017-10-8 22:02:43
encode 已经解决,浏览模式看到还是字符,以为没改变,其实已经更改。

encode province,gen(nprovince)
label drop nprovince
fre province
recode nprovince 1=2 2=3 3=1 4=3 5=1 6=3 7=1 8=1 9=3 10=2 11=3 12/14=2 15=1 ///
                 16=3 17=2 18=2 19=3 20/21=1 22/23=3 24=1 25=2 ///
                                 26=1 27=3 28/30=1 31=3,gen (region) lab(region) test
lab def region 1 "西部" 2 "中部" 3 "东部"
lab val region region
lab var region "地区划分"
fre region

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2025-12-31 03:47